完整代码:import xlwings as xw import requests from bs4 import BeautifulSoup from datetime import datetime import json import xlwt import xlwings as xw from selenium import webdriver import time import pan
针对工程需求精度不够,目前只能识别率为86%左右。用tesseract的深度学习可能会好一点,没搞懂怎么用?单张图片import cv2import numpy as npimport matplotlib.pyplot as pltimport pytesseractimport ospytesseract.pytesseract.tesseract_cmd = r"C:\Program Files (x86)\Tesseract-OCR\tesseract.exe"img_
原创 2021-11-22 16:58:46
1311阅读
# 使用Python和Pytesseract识别数字 在计算机视觉和OCR领域,Pytesseract是一个常用的Python库,它是Google的Tesseract-OCR引擎的一个封装。Tesseract-OCR是一个开源的OCR引擎,可以用于将图像中的文本转换为可编辑的文本。在本文中,我们将使用Python和Pytesseract库来识别数字。 ## 准备工作 首先,我们需要安装Pyte
原创 2023-07-22 06:28:53
1939阅读
 一、环境配置1.1需要 pillow 和 pytesseract 这两个库,pip install 安装就好了。  pip install pillow -i http://pypi.douban.com/simple --trusted-host pypi.douban.com pip install pytesseract -i http://pypi.doub
刚刚学到验证码的识别,需要安装tesserorc利用OCR技术(光学字符识别)来进行验证码识别,在此过程遇到许多问题,现在来总结总结。安装环境:windows10+Python3+anaconda31. tesseract的安装tesserorc是python的一个OCR识别库,不过他是对tesseract做的一层python API封装,核心还是tesseract,所以要调用python的tes
一、开发环境开发语言 : python 3.6.13使用框架 :TensorFlow 2.5.0 + Keras 2.5.0开发工具 :PyCharm 2020.2.2 x64二、项目目录说明此次复现的主要代码文件有:simpleDemo.py参考了书目《Python 深度学习》,是一个最简单的数字识别。从 Kears 的 datasets 中导入 mnist, 并使用简单的隐藏层进行训练。com
文章目录Win 平台使用步骤问题解决Ref:Win 平台使用步骤import pytesseractfrom PIL import Imageif __name__
原创 2021-12-01 14:34:17
602阅读
文章目录Win 平台使用步骤问题解决Ref:Win 平台使用步骤import pytesseractfrom PIL import Imageif __name__ == '__main__': file = Image.open("test.bmp")
原创 2022-01-11 11:41:41
3232阅读
opencv学习之OCRtesseract.exe的下载及安装介绍:下载地址:网盘下载地址:安装指导:1、双击.exe文件,直接点击下步即可,注意安装的环境路径!!!2、将安装的环境路径添加到windows的系统环境中,最好在用户变量的path中和系统环境的path中都做好添加。测试安装是否成功:win+R 打开cmd:输入命令:tesseract -v系统会输出版本信息即表示安装成功。pyte
基于pytesseract进行图片文字识别前言一、模块pytesseract实现图片文字OCR识别过程1.了解2.下载3.后续添加语言4.下载相应的库二、使用步骤总结 前言我有一个图片,他上面的文字我觉得对我有用,我想把它摘下来,但是,我懒,不想一个一个手巧,又不想借助其他的软件进行识别,就想自己写串代码实现图片的文字识别,怎么办呢?来瞅瞅这篇文章吧(此文章最好用于截图之类规范文章的图片)。一、模
编程环境:win10,python3.6,Anaconda搭建tensorflow(CPU版),Pycharm添加anaconda中的tensorflow环境书写代码。环境安装搭建的话,参考网上资源。Anaconda各版本安装包:https://mirrors.tuna.tsinghua.edu.cn/anaconda/archive/,安装的是Anaconda3-5.2.0版本(python3.
转载 9月前
301阅读
1点赞
(3)程序实现经过 借助Tesseract软件OCR进行文本检测(1)_没有水的海绵的博客-博客的学习,相信博友对如何实现下图所示的效果有了些许猜想,通过pytesseract类中的image_to_boxes和image_to_data函数可以得到有关识别文本的位置、大小和文本内容等信息,经过一些转换便可以实现下图所示效果。而上一篇讲解的3个函数中的image_to_string的输出
python的数字类型分为三种,分别是整数int、 浮点数float 和 复数complex。 数字是由数字字面值或内置函数与运算符的结果来创建的, 不带修饰的整数字面值会生成整数。包含小数点或幂运算符的数字字面值会生成浮点数。在数字字面值末尾加上 ‘j’ 或 ‘J’ 会生成虚数(实部为零的复数),可以将其与整数或浮点数相加来得到具有实部和虚部的复数。混合算术Python 完全支持混合算术,当一个
原创 2022-01-06 10:17:41
649阅读
其实也不算自己写的,在网上东找找西找找,合一块问题就解决了。和谐社会的程序猿不都这样么。。上正菜。先安装pillowwindows 10上面先打开命令提示符:注:不知道为啥我装python 3.5的时候蛋疼的选择了管理员安装,所以运行命令提示符的话也需要管理员权限。怎么操作就不说了。1. 安装Pillow2. 安装pytesseract3. 再安装tesseract-ocr,注意这个很关系是文字识
# Python pytesseract识别度不高的解决方法 ## 1. 简介 在使用Python进行图像处理和文本识别时,pytesseract是一个常用的工具库。然而,有时候我们可能会遇到识别度不高的问题,特别是对于一些复杂或噪声较多的图像。本文将介绍如何解决"Python pytesseract识别度不高"的问题。 ## 2. 解决流程 首先,让我们来看一下整个解决问题的流程。下面是
原创 11月前
1223阅读
目录1、获取tesseract版本号2、获取语言包列表3、识别图片中的文字4、获取图片中文字的详细信息5、识别图片中的文字和位置6、识别osd信息7、识别并生成xml文件避坑指南: pytesseract是对Tesseract-OCR命令行的封装,实际上底层调用的还是tesseract可执行文件,所以在使用pytesseract前需要完成Tesseract-OCR软件安装和语言包安装,详
pytesseract是基于谷歌的tesseract的OCR包,支持识别一些简单的数字、字母、中文。
原创 1月前
37阅读
7. cv2.putText(img, text, loc, text_font, font_scale, color, linestick)# 参数说明:img表示输入图片,text表示需要填写的文本str格式,loc表示文本在图中的位置,font_size可以使用cv2.FONT_HERSHEY_SIMPLEX, font_scale表示文本的规格,color表示文本颜色,lines
python开发:开源pytesseract文字识别
原创 2022-09-27 16:23:06
291阅读
  • 1
  • 2
  • 3
  • 4
  • 5